What is the main purpose of DeBakey Vascular Forceps?

The main purpose of DeBakey Vascular Forceps is to grasp tissue without damaging it. These forceps are designed with a unique, atraumatic serrated edge that allows for a secure grip on delicate tissues and blood vessels during surgical procedures. This feature is crucial in vascular surgery, where preserving the integrity of vascular structures and surrounding tissues is vital to ensure successful outcomes.

The design of these forceps minimizes tissue trauma, which is key in complex surgeries where precision is paramount. The ability to handle tissues delicately while providing sufficient grip helps maintain control during intricate maneuvers in the surgical field. Therefore, their primary function aligns perfectly with the necessity to handle tissues gently and effectively, making them an essential tool in various surgical settings.
